We are currently seeking a Configuration Management Analyst, Journeyman (Temporary) to support PMA-276 at the Patuxent River, MD Program Office. The candidate will be a member of the Configuration Management/Data Management Team, will report to the CM lead and shall provide configuration management support. A Journeyman level person typically works on mission critical aspects of a given program and performs all functional duties independently. THIS IS A TEMPORARY POSITION that may become a full-time position, but there are no guarantees.

Collects, organizes and interprets data relating to aircraft and product programs. Maintains configuration control of acquisition products and data. Tracks configuration changes. Coordinates and supports development of Engineering Change Proposals. Applies government-instituted processes for documentation, change control management and data management.

Duties and Responsibilities: Duties may include, but are not limited to:

* Participate as a member of the Configuration Management/Data Management (CM/DM) team supporting PMA-276 programs and initiatives.

* Provide Configuration Management support for developmental and sustainment efforts, ensuring compliance with NAVAIR CM policies, processes, and lifecycle requirements.

* Support the development, review, and coordination of Engineering Change Proposals (ECPs) and other configuration change documentation throughout the change management process.

* Maintain configuration control and status accounting of program documentation, ensuring accurate tracking of product baselines, configuration changes, and associated records.

* Utilize enterprise CM tools (e.g., ECM and related systems) to enter, track, and manage change packages, technical documentation, and associated data.

* Coordinate with IPT Leads, engineers, logisticians, contractors, and other program stakeholders to ensure configuration changes are properly documented, reviewed, and implemented.

* Monitor and track time-sensitive program documentation and ensure required inputs are submitted accurately and within established timelines.

* Support Configuration Control Board (CCB) activities by assisting with change package preparation, technical reviews, and documentation management.

* Prepare and present configuration status updates and analysis to program leadership and team members as required.

* Utilize Microsoft Office and collaboration tools (Outlook, Teams, Excel, Word, PowerPoint, SharePoint) to organize, manage, and communicate program data and documentation.
